Output 6df42bb07f7f890d32240c71391ac43128975d3e1f2d2d1ee125b1cce0f66de3:5

value
66081639
script pubkey
OP_0 OP_PUSHBYTES_32 4891f638dac11659ea995183682f8aef6c1c4e1b2c2767c8b94f743feb2fa74c
address
bc1qfzglvwx6cyt9n65e2xpkstu2aakpcnsm9snk0j9efa6rl6e05axqfx8gz7
transaction
6df42bb07f7f890d32240c71391ac43128975d3e1f2d2d1ee125b1cce0f66de3
spent
true